📰 What Happened

New research from Rensselaer Polytechnic Institute reveals that U.S. estuaries are experiencing warming waters, increased algal growth, and declining oxygen levels, which threaten water quality and fish populations.

  • Estuaries are critical ecosystems that support diverse marine life.
  • The trends observed in U.S. estuaries are indicative of broader global environmental challenges.

📚 Background

Estuaries are transition zones between river environments and maritime environments, and they are crucial for biodiversity and water quality.

Estuaries across the United States are facing the same trends of warming waters, algal growth and declining oxygen concentrations that threaten water quality and fish populations, regardless of geographic location, according to new research led by a Rensselaer Polytechnic Institute (RPI) faculty member.
